According to the entered license plate (eg. ABC123
) and a list of replacement values (eg 1
replaced by I
). I need to get all possibles combinations.
For example:
1 => I
3 => B
A => H
0 (zero) => O
O => 0 (zero)
Input :
ABC123
Expected output :
ABC123, ABCI23, ABCI28, ABC128, HBC123, HBCI23, HBCI28, HBC128
I tried with String Combinations With Character Replacement, but I can't...

It can easily be done by utilizing the algorithm from my answer to Looking at each combination in jagged array:
public static class Algorithms
{
public static IEnumerable<string> GetCombinations(this char[][] input)
{
var result = new char[input.Length];
var indices = new int[input.Length];
for (int pos = 0, index = 0; ;)
{
for (; pos < input.Length; pos++, index = 0)
{
indices[pos] = index;
result[pos] = input[pos][index];
}
yield return new string(result);
do
{
if (pos == 0) yield break;
index = indices[--pos] + 1;
}
while (index >= input[pos].Length);
}
}
}
by adding the following method:
public static IEnumerable<string> GetCombinations(this string input, Dictionary<char, char> replacements)
{
return input.Select(c =>
{
char r;
return replacements.TryGetValue(c, out r) && c != r ? new[] { c, r } : new[] { c };
}).ToArray().GetCombinations();
}
Sample usage:
var replacements = new Dictionary<char, char> { { '1', 'I' }, { '3', '8' }, { 'A', 'H' }, { '0', 'O' }, { 'O', '0' } };
var test = "ABC123".GetCombinations(replacements);
foreach (var comb in test) Console.WriteLine(comb);

You can do it using recursion, iterate for each character and call recursively using the original character and the replacement, something like this:
public static IEnumerable<string> Combinations(string s, Dictionary<char, char> replacements)
{
return Combinations(s, replacements, 0, string.Empty);
}
private static IEnumerable<string> Combinations(string original, Dictionary<char, char> replacements, int index, string current)
{
if (index == original.Length) yield return current;
else
{
foreach (var item in Combinations(original, replacements, index + 1, current + original[index]))
yield return item;
if (replacements.ContainsKey(original[index]))
foreach (var item in Combinations(original, replacements, index + 1, current + replacements[original[index]]))
yield return item;
}
}
And call this methods like so:
Dictionary<char, char> dict = new Dictionary<char,char>();
dict['1'] = 'I';
dict['3'] = 'B';
dict['A'] = 'H';
dict['O'] = '0';
dict['0'] = 'O';
var combs = Combinations("ABC123", dict);
